What impact does El Niño Southern Oscillation have on global weather patterns?
El Niño Southern Oscillation (ENSO) influences global weather by altering atmospheric circulation, leading to various impacts such as increased rainfall in South America, droughts in Southeast Asia and Australia, and warmer temperatures in the central and eastern Pacific. Changes in cyclone activity and shifts in marine and terrestrial ecosystems also occur.
How does El Niño Southern Oscillation affect marine ecosystems?
El Niño Southern Oscillation affects marine ecosystems by disrupting food chains; it alters ocean temperatures and currents, causing nutrient-rich cold water to be replaced by warmer, nutrient-poor water, which can lead to declines in fish populations, coral bleaching, and impacts on marine biodiversity and fishing industries.
How does El Niño Southern Oscillation influence agriculture and food security?
El Niño Southern Oscillation affects agriculture and food security by causing extreme weather patterns, such as droughts and floods, which can disrupt crop yields and food production. This leads to increased food prices and food scarcity, negatively impacting food security, particularly in regions dependent on agriculture.
What are the phases of the El Niño Southern Oscillation cycle?
The El Niño Southern Oscillation (ENSO) cycle consists of three phases: El Niño, characterized by the warming of ocean surface temperatures in the central and eastern Pacific Ocean; La Niña, marked by cooler-than-average ocean surface temperatures in the same region; and the Neutral phase, where conditions are neither warm nor cool.
How does El Niño Southern Oscillation contribute to climate change?
El Niño Southern Oscillation (ENSO) itself is not a direct cause of climate change but it can exacerbate climate variability. ENSO events lead to significant fluctuations in global weather patterns, temperatures, and precipitation, which can influence short-term climate anomalies and impact ecosystems, agriculture, and water resources globally.
